Game details
PSIM Yogyakarta played against Madura United in Liga 1 (Indonesia). The game was played on May 17, 2026. Final score: 2:1.

xG per shot around 0.08 usually means long-range attempts; 0.15+ usually means box chances. The style label comes from possession, shot volume and conversion.
* xG (expected goals) says how many goals a team should score from its chances. If actual goals are above xG, finishing is above average; if below xG, chances are being missed.
